Investigation into Palm Springs fertility clinic bombing continues

Fire trucks at the scene of the Palm Springs explosion with debris lining the street around them Photo courtesy of OnScene TV The examination is continuing Sunday to identify the deadly bomber and a practicable motive for what law enforcement executives described as an intentional act of terrorism at a Palm Springs fertility clinic CNN citing a law enforcement source explained the bomber had preliminarily been identified as a -year-old man from the nearby city of Twentynine Palms who acted alone Due to the condition of the deceased individual s remains after the explosion forensic testing will be conducted to help fully identify the suspect CNN revealed Agents are also aware of a rambling audio recording posted online in which a man describes his intention to attack an in vitro fertilization clinic and they are working to determine whether it is associated with the circumstance the architecture released again citing its law enforcement source In the oftentimes incoherent audio message the speaker discusses various grievances about his life but the specific connection to IVF is unclear according to CNN Other media reports mentioned the speaker on the recording described himself as anti-life and opposed to in vitro fertilization Palm Springs police Chief Andy Mills verified that one person died in the a m Saturday blast in the block of North Indian Canyon Dr near the American Reproductive Centers fertility clinic which was closed at the time of the episode North Indian Canyon Drive The victim s identity has not been circulated Make no mistake This is an intentional act of terrorism disclosed Akil Davis assistant director in charge of the FBI in Los Angeles This is one of the largest bombing investigations we ve had in Southern California Reporters sought whether the victim was also the bomber We have a person of interest in this review Davis disclosed We are not actively searching for a suspect He mentioned the identity of the deceased and the person s relationship to the bombing would eventually be made citizens but only after its release would not compromise the research This is an isolated occurrence noted Mills The group is not at danger any longer Los Angeles TV station ABC citing an unnamed law enforcement source released that four people were injured in the explosion and that the person who died was a suspect A host of federal executives descended on the scene as crews worked to collect evidence in the sizeable blast area Mills described the crime scene as several blocks in all directions and sought anyone who finds anything that could be evidence to call police Shortly after the explosion the FBI posted that it was responding with police and fire partners to the scene of an explosion on N Indian Canyon Drive in Palm Springs FBI assets being deployed include investigators bomb technicians and an evidence response unit Please contact local personnel for safety precautions in the area Nicole Lozano spokeswoman for the Bureau of Alcohol Tobacco Firearms and Explosives in Los Angeles mentioned ATF personnel were also on the scene of the explosion saying The Bureau of Alcohol Tobacco Firearms and Explosives Los Angeles Field Division personnel are assisting our state local and federal counterparts with the progressing analysis by providing our unique capabilities and technical expertise An image posted online by a witness manifested what appeared to be at least part of a body near the blast scene which was later covered with a white blanket Other images manifested the remains of a truck in the parking lot behind the clinic and the clinic s front facade in the street Witness video indicated scattered debris in the street in front of the clinic and windows shattered at multiple businesses in the area including a nearby liquor store Residents released feeling the shaking from the blast throughout the city The clinic is located near Desert Regional Medicinal Center which did not sustain any serious damage According to the American Reproductive Centers website the clinic opened in and is the Coachella Valley s first and only full-service fertility center and IVF in vitro fertilization lab Its services also include LGBTQ family building egg donation and freezing fertility evaluations and embryo transfer Mayor Pro Tem Naomi Soto reported it was key that the largest part heavily damaged building was a fertility clinic a place of hope She added This meaningful work must continue Dr Maher Abdallah who runs the clinic posted a message on social media saying the facility s office space was damaged but the lab was untouched He authenticated that no employees of the clinic were injured We are immensely grateful to share that no members of the ARC association were harmed and our lab including all eggs embryos and reproductive materials remains fully secure and undamaged Abdallah reported We are heavily conducting a complete safety inspection and have established that our operations and sensitive healthcare areas were not impacted by the blast Our mission has unfailingly been to help build families and in times like these we are reminded of just how fragile and precious life is In the face of this tragedy we remain committed to creating hope because we believe that healing begins with locality compassion and care Out of every tragedy there is an opportunity to come together with deeper purpose While in contemporary times s events have shaken us all they also shine a light on the strength of our region the bravery of our first responders and the resilience of the families we serve Abdallah mentioned He added that the clinic would be open for business on Monday despite the extensive damage Desert Regional Healthcare Center issued a message saying Hospital staff is cooperating with police as they investigate the cause Our crisis department remains open and our hospital is fully operational We are temporarily asking visitors to refrain from coming to the hospital as police have limited access to the road in front of our campus Various windows were broken in a curative office building directly facing the explosion Hospital operations have not been affected Gov Gavin Newsom s office issued a report saying the governor has been briefed on the explosion The state through the Office of Exigency Services is coordinating with local and federal agents to sponsorship the response according to Newsom s office Palm Springs Mayor Ron DeHarte stated he had been in touch with Newsom s office and other elected executives including Sen Alex Padilla My heart is heavy as we grapple with the horrific explosion that occurred outside the American Reproductive Centers DeHarte stated in a report late Saturday This act of violence is unforgivable and I want to be clear it has no place in our district The safety and well-being of our residents is our absolute priority We are a strong and resilient group and we will stand together in the face of this tragedy We will not let fear define us DeHarte urged people who find likely evidence to not touch it and instead call the police department at -
